Anxiety in general is from an unconscious or conscious. fear of something. If your doctor said you are fine it is because you didn't tell him enough to make a diagnosis or you didn't tell him how bad and how long it had effected you. There are different types of anxiety disorders including Generalized Anxiety Disorder (G.A.D.), Social Anxiety Disorder (S.A.D.) etc.There are medications for anxiety as well as therapy by a psychologist or psychiatrist.
The latter amounts to finding out what is causing your fear and learning to put it into perspective and/or facing it. You can do this to a certain extent on your own but it helps to have another to share the burden.
